Transaction efec16e77cbf18c370170017f83a0a3ec39f540d66e2359c77357e7c1d2f30b1
1 Input
1 Output
-
efec16e77cbf18c370170017f83a0a3ec39f540d66e2359c77357e7c1d2f30b1:0
- value
- 149293
- script pubkey
- OP_0 OP_PUSHBYTES_20 9ac941d211f632e025f0908d10ac6873aee3a035
- address
- bc1qnty5r5s37cewqf0sjzx3ptrgwwhw8gp4df0puv